“Over the Rainbow,” composed by Harold Arlen with lyrics by Yip Harburg in 1939 for the film The Wizard of Oz, quickly became a beloved standard in jazz and popular music.
Its 32-bar AABA form and soaring melody make it ideal for vocal interpretation and instrumental improvisation. Notable jazz versions include those by Art Tatum, Ella Fitzgerald, and Chet Baker.
The song’s emotional depth and harmonic richness continue to inspire generations of jazz musicians.
